More Crime in Donegal Town

Two arrested in Donegal Town still in custody (From OceanFM) Aug 22, 5:32 pm Two men arrested in Donegal Town in seperate incidents over the weekend remain in custody today. Both men appeared at a special sitting of Donegal Town District Court on Sunday evening last. Gardai arrested an Iranian national following a stabbing at the Cliffview hostel on the Killybegs road in Donegal Town in the early hours of Sunday morning. 26 year old Mohamid Ompor, with an address at Cliffview hostel appeared before a special sitting of Donegal Town District Court on Sunday evening and was remanded in custody to Castlerea prison having been charged with assault causing harm to a man from Kuwait who also lives at the hostel. Mr Ompar who will reappear at Donegal District Court on Thursday afternoon next. The injured party did not require hospital treatment and is today recovering from the ordeal. Meanwhile, Gardai arrested an 19 year old Derry man following a high speed pursuit in the early hours of Sunday morning which ended with a car crashing into the roundabout at Drumlongher, Donegal Town. James Coyle from 9, Greenhall Crescent, Racecourse Road in Derry was arrested following a high speed pursuit of a stolen car which began in Ballyshannon in the early hours of Sunday morning. Two thousand euro of damage was caused to a Garda car which was rammed by the offending vehicle at Drumlonagher on the main Letterkenny to Ballyshannon road just before 3am on Sunday. The accused was charged with seven counts of dangerous driving, one of having no insurance, failing to stop for Gardai and an unauthorised taking of the vehicle. Mr. Coyle is being detained at St Patrick’s Institution in Dublin and will also reappear in Donegal Town Court on Thursday next. Bail was not granted by Judge Conal Gibbons.
